Alexander Isak has revealed that the chance to add to Liverpool's illustrious legacy was a key factor in his decision to join the Reds for a British record transfer fee.
The Sweden international finalized his switch to Merseyside on transfer deadline day. This followed the Premier League champions bringing an end to a protracted summer pursuit by reaching agreement on the enormous fee with Newcastle United, mere hours after their 1-0 triumph over Arsenal on August 31.
Once the fee was settled, Isak made his way to the club's AXA Training Centre the next day for his medical examination before fulfilling media obligations with the club.
Speaking in their exclusive behind-the-scenes footage of a momentous day for both the club and the striker, the ex-Magpies forward reflected on becoming the Reds' new No. 9.
"It's unbelievable," he says in the YouTube vlog. "It's something I never could have dreamed of as a child.
"Such a big club, and to be a part of what the club is building on top of the club's history and what it has already achieved, it is something I am so proud of.

"I'm so happy that I'm finally here. I can't wait to get back out there and hopefully we can share some amazing moments together.
"I want to create history, I want to win trophies; this is the perfect place for me to grow even further.
"It's been a busy morning, I travelled from Newcastle down to Liverpool and I am looking forward to seeing the stadium.
"Yeah, it's going to be amazing man. I've got a medical that is underway now and I'm going to hospital for some more scans and then back to finish off paperwork and do the rest of the media."
Isak featured for the first time since May on Monday evening when he came off the bench for Sweden during their 2-0 World Cup qualifier loss to Kosovo.
